The Opportunity

As the Maintenance Mechanic 2 for Auxiliary Facilities Services, you will perform routine and emergency maintenance and repairs on facilities, equipment, and plant systems in residential apartments, residence halls, and dining centers. You will coordinate and collaborate with other trades and crafts to install and assemble new equipment and systems in support of new construction and remodeling projects. You will lead apprentices or helpers as assigned and operate motor vehicles as required.

Salary

Monthly Salary: $5,011 to $5,812 (Range 48G Steps G - M). Successful candidates are typically hired at the beginning of the salary range and receive scheduled salary increment increases in accordance with WAC 357-28. In accordance with RCW 49.58.110, the above salary reflects the full salary range for this position. Individual placement within the range is based on the candidate's current experience, education, skills, and abilities related to the position.

Required Qualifications
  • High school graduation and four years of general work experience in building and equipment maintenance, construction or repair work or completion of a recognized apprenticeship in a skilled mechanic trade; OR equivalent education/experience.
  • Must have, or be able to obtain by time of hire, a valid driver's license and meet requirements in accordance with SPPM 7.10 and departmental driving standards.
